a b s t r a c t

Building integrated photovoltaics (BIPVs) are photovoltaic (PV) modules integrated into the building

envelope and hence also replacing traditional parts of the building envelope, e.g. the roofing. In this

context, the BIPVs integration with the building envelope limits the costs by serving dual purposes.

BIPVs have a great advantage compared to non-integrated systems because there is neither need for

allocation of land nor stand-alone PV systems. This study seeks to outline various commercially

available approaches to BIPVs and thus provides a state-of-the-art review. In addition, possible future

research opportunities are explored.

The various categories of BIPVs may be divided into photovoltaic foils, photovoltaic tiles, photo-

voltaic modules and solar cell glazings. Silicon materials are the most commonly used, and a distinction

is made between wafer-based technologies and thin-film technologies. In addition, various non-silicon

materials are available. The main options for building integration of PV cells are on sloped roofs, flat

roofs and facades. The evaluation of the different BIPV products involves, among others, properties such

as solar cell efficiency, open circuit voltage, short circuit current, maximum effect and fill factor.

It is expected that the BIPV systems will improve in the years to come, regarding both device and

manufacturing efficiency. The future seems very promising in the BIPV industry, both concerning new

technologies, different solutions and the variety of BIPV options.

1. Introduction

Currently, the world is using fossil fuel at an alarming rate that not only will strain the sources in the near future, but will result in a great amount of pollution as well. The power industry emissions were 10.9 gigatonnes of carbon dioxide equivalents (GtCO2e) per year in 2005, i.e. 24% of global Greenhouse Gas (GHG) emissions, and this is expected to increase to 18.7 GtCO2e per year in 2030 [41]. ‘‘Carbon dioxide equivalent is the unit for emissions that, for a given mixture and amount of greenhouse gas, represents the amount of CO2 that would have the same global warming potential (GWP) when measured over a specified timescale (generally 100 years)’’ [41].
